Embodiment 1
[0016] Embodiment 1: A waste oil pretreatment process of the present invention includes the following steps: adding waste oil into the pressure-resistant reactor of the reaction device, gradually turning on the steam under stirring and raising the temperature to 80°C, and then adding 40% of the total weight of waste oil Add the following decomposition agents in order: 2.5% concentrated sulfuric acid, 1.5% phosphoric acid, 1.5% sulfoxylyl fatty acid, the amount of the above decomposition agents is the weight percentage calculated based on the total weight of waste oil, continue Raise the temperature to 130°C, adjust the steam pressure and supply, and keep the temperature and pressure stable. After that, take a sample of the reaction material every hour to measure the acid value of the material.
